Output 662aaeeb83c95b33ea9a3d28f564e936e33f4e69d1da558bee37eca3f21fccde:0

value
6140170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f826fbcb433ec6590ec64ca51449ef138f935b3f OP_EQUAL
address
3QK8Ck5t9ZLoSzxbAPCps5nBa6cQPGD3J5
transaction
662aaeeb83c95b33ea9a3d28f564e936e33f4e69d1da558bee37eca3f21fccde
spent
true